Switzerland, a symphony of nature’s grandeur, unfolds like a meticulously crafted film. Imagine the opening scene: majestic Alps piercing the sky, their snow-capped peaks glistening in the morning sun. The camera pans across emerald valleys, where cows graze on lush meadows, their bells chiming in harmony with the breeze.

As the story progresses, we traverse cobblestone streets in charming villages. Each frame captures the essence of Swiss life: timbered chalets, geranium-filled window boxes, and the comforting aroma of Swiss chocolate wafting from cozy patisseries.

The soundtrack swells as we ascend to the Jungfraujoch, the “Top of Europe.” Here, clouds part to reveal a glacier-clad wonderland—a celestial amphitheater where ice meets sky. Our hearts race as we step onto the First Cliff Walk, suspended over a vertiginous abyss. The camera captures our breathless awe as we gaze at the Eiger, Mönch, and Jungfrau—silent sentinels guarding this alpine paradise.

Next, we sail across Lake Lucerne, its cerulean waters framed by medieval bridges and storybook castles. The sun dips behind the mountains, casting a golden glow on the water. We disembark in Interlaken, where adrenaline junkies leap from paragliders, their joyous screams echoing through the valleys.

In the heart of Zurich, the city pulses with sophistication. The lens captures the sleek lines of the Bahnhofstrasse, Europe’s most exclusive shopping boulevard. We sip espresso at a café, watching trams glide by, their bells harmonizing with the city’s rhythm.

As twilight envelops the Château de Chillon on Lake Geneva, we step into a medieval tale. The castle’s stone walls guard secrets of knights and troubadours. The moon reflects on the water, and we imagine whispered conversations echoing through time.

Our final scene unfolds in Zermatt, where the Matterhorn stands sentinel. We board the Gornergrat Railway, ascending to a panorama that defies description. The sun paints the peaks in hues of rose and gold, and we raise our cameras, capturing eternity in a single frame.

Switzerland—the celluloid dream where reality transcends imagination. As the credits roll, we know this journey will linger—a cinematic masterpiece etched in our hearts forever.
